NodeInfo interface
有关 Service Fabric 群集中的节点的信息。
属性
| code |
运行节点的 Service Fabric 二进制文件的版本。 |
| config |
节点正在使用的 Service Fabric 群集清单的版本。 |
| fault |
节点的容错域。 |
| health |
Service Fabric 实体的运行状况状态,例如群集、节点、应用程序、服务、分区、副本等。可能的值包括:“Invalid”、“Ok”、“Warning”、“Error”、“Unknown” |
| id | Service Fabric 用于唯一标识节点的内部 ID。 从节点名称确定性地生成节点 ID。 |
| instance |
表示节点实例的 ID。 虽然节点的 ID 从节点名称确定性地生成,并在重启时保持不变,但每次节点重启时,InstanceId 都会更改。 |
| ip |
节点的 IP 地址或完全限定的域名。 |
| is |
指示节点是否为种子节点。 如果节点是种子节点,则返回 true,否则返回 false。 正确作 Service Fabric 群集需要种子节点的仲裁。 |
| is |
指示是否通过调用停止节点 API 来停止节点。 如果节点已停止,则返回 true,否则返回 false。 |
| name | Service Fabric 节点的名称。 |
| node |
有关节点停用的信息。 此信息对于正在停用或已停用的节点有效。 |
| node |
节点关闭时的 UTC 日期时间。 如果节点从未关闭,则此值将为零日期时间。 |
| node |
节点处于 NodeStatus Down 中的时间(以秒为单位)。 值零表示节点不是 NodeStatus Down。 |
| node |
节点的状态。 可能的值包括:“Invalid”、“Up”、“Down”、“Enabling”、“Disableing”、“Disabled”、“Unknown”、“Removed” |
| node |
节点出现时的 UTC 日期时间。 如果节点从未启动,则此值将为零日期时间。 |
| node |
节点处于 NodeStatus Up 中的时间(以秒为单位)。 值零表示节点不向上。 |
| type | 节点的类型。 |
| upgrade |
节点的升级域。 |
属性详细信息
codeVersion
运行节点的 Service Fabric 二进制文件的版本。
codeVersion?: string
属性值
string
configVersion
节点正在使用的 Service Fabric 群集清单的版本。
configVersion?: string
属性值
string
faultDomain
节点的容错域。
faultDomain?: string
属性值
string
healthState
Service Fabric 实体的运行状况状态,例如群集、节点、应用程序、服务、分区、副本等。可能的值包括:“Invalid”、“Ok”、“Warning”、“Error”、“Unknown”
healthState?: HealthState
属性值
id
instanceId
表示节点实例的 ID。 虽然节点的 ID 从节点名称确定性地生成,并在重启时保持不变,但每次节点重启时,InstanceId 都会更改。
instanceId?: string
属性值
string
ipAddressOrFQDN
节点的 IP 地址或完全限定的域名。
ipAddressOrFQDN?: string
属性值
string
isSeedNode
指示节点是否为种子节点。 如果节点是种子节点,则返回 true,否则返回 false。 正确作 Service Fabric 群集需要种子节点的仲裁。
isSeedNode?: boolean
属性值
boolean
isStopped
指示是否通过调用停止节点 API 来停止节点。 如果节点已停止,则返回 true,否则返回 false。
isStopped?: boolean
属性值
boolean
name
Service Fabric 节点的名称。
name?: string
属性值
string
nodeDeactivationInfo
nodeDownAt
节点关闭时的 UTC 日期时间。 如果节点从未关闭,则此值将为零日期时间。
nodeDownAt?: Date
属性值
Date
nodeDownTimeInSeconds
节点处于 NodeStatus Down 中的时间(以秒为单位)。 值零表示节点不是 NodeStatus Down。
nodeDownTimeInSeconds?: string
属性值
string
nodeStatus
节点的状态。 可能的值包括:“Invalid”、“Up”、“Down”、“Enabling”、“Disableing”、“Disabled”、“Unknown”、“Removed”
nodeStatus?: NodeStatus
属性值
nodeUpAt
节点出现时的 UTC 日期时间。 如果节点从未启动,则此值将为零日期时间。
nodeUpAt?: Date
属性值
Date
nodeUpTimeInSeconds
节点处于 NodeStatus Up 中的时间(以秒为单位)。 值零表示节点不向上。
nodeUpTimeInSeconds?: string
属性值
string
type
节点的类型。
type?: string
属性值
string
upgradeDomain
节点的升级域。
upgradeDomain?: string
属性值
string